Linus Torvalds wrote: > > On Sat, 3 Jan 2009, Ingo Molnar wrote: >> ok. The pending regressions are all fixed now, and i've just finished my >> standard tests on the latest tree and all the tests passed fine. > > Ok, pulled and pushed out. > > Has anybody looked at what the stack size is with MAXSMP set with an > allyesconfig? And what areas are still problematic, if any? Are we going > to have some code-paths that still essentially have 1kB+ of stack space > just because they haven't been converted and still have the cpu mask on > stack? > > Linus
Hi Linus,
Yes, I do periodically collect stats for memory and stack usage. Here is a recent stack summary (not "allyes", but most all trace/debug options turned on). It shows the stack growth from a 128 NR_CPUS config to a MAXSMP (4096 NR_CPUS) config. Most of the changes to correct these "stack hogs" have been sitting in a queue until the changes affecting non-x86 architectures have been accepted (which you just did), though some are because of new code from the merge activity.
Rusty has introduced a config option that disables the old cpumask_t which really highlights where the offenders still are. Ultimately, that should prevent any new stack hogs from being introduced, but it won't be settable until 2.6.30 time frame.
